【发布时间】:2012-07-17 14:20:49
【问题描述】:
我想使用 Windows 集成安全性通过网络(或 VPN)连接到 SQL 服务器实例。
我需要哪些步骤才能完成此任务? 我正在使用 Winforms。
【问题讨论】:
标签: winforms security integrated
我想使用 Windows 集成安全性通过网络(或 VPN)连接到 SQL 服务器实例。
我需要哪些步骤才能完成此任务? 我正在使用 Winforms。
【问题讨论】:
标签: winforms security integrated
您需要从配置文件中提供一个连接字符串并使用它来创建 SQL 连接;集成安全性的典型示例可能是:
Persist Security Info=False;
User ID=frosty;Password=flakes;
Initial Catalog=milkjug;
Data Source=supermarket
Integrated Security=True;
provider=System.Data.SqlClient;
其中“超市”是您完全限定的数据库名称(或 IP 地址);这也可以包括端口号。
在您的代码中,如下所示:
SqlClient.SqlConnection myConnection = New SqlClient.SqlConnection();
myConnection.ConnectionString = myConnectionString;
myConnection.Open();
以上内容未经测试,来自记忆 - 应该可以解决问题或至少为您指明正确的方向。
【讨论】: